Re: Focusing screen for Nikon FE

Hi Gordon,
I just received my E3 focusing screen: it's brighter.
I preferred the E3 because of the grid.
I made two tests:
1. on the same Nikon FE with two different screens (K, the old one, and
E3) to have the same exposure time
2. on two different cameras (a Nikon FM3A with its K3 screen and a Nikon
FE with the upgraded E3 focusing screen) to have the same exposure times.
I can confirm +1/2 EV is required to use E3 (and I think all new
focusing screens) on a Nikon FE.
I'm happy because the screen is good as expected, it's brighter and my
old Nikon FE exposure measurements are good since the exposure
compensation is exactly as expected!
I'll never change my Nikon FE! It's simply perfect! :-)

Re: Focusing screen for Nikon FE

Supposedly the newer screens are brighter, which in theory would make
allow more light to fall upon the metering cells. However, in practice
they are not much different. If you want to increase exposure slightly
using the exposure compensation dial on the FE, that is one thing to try
out. Definitely test this trying out similar shots; the actual in
practice difference might be so little that you find using no exposure
compensation works fine.
